| Re: Is Crysis any good? I've played it, several times, and definitely had a "good" time doing so. It is, in large, a really impressive tech demo. The story was cliche and the characters were forgettable and while there were quite a few elements that had a lot of promise, the game simply didn't gel. That being said, there were some truly breathtaking moments throughout that make it worth playing just to experience. |

| Re: Is Crysis any good? Its a short game (long tech demo) but over all enjoyable, IMO. I would say if you have a reasonable computer/vid card and can get the game cheap to give it a try. Download the free demo it has some of the best play of the game...and will give an indication if your comp will play it well (the frozen level of the game will take many more resources/play much worse and is not included in the demo; so be aware that if your machine will barely play the demo you should expect problems later (it can help to adjust the graphics settings to low).
